页面性能监控指标有哪些?

在当今互联网时代,网站页面性能的好坏直接影响到用户体验和搜索引擎优化(SEO)。为了确保网站能够为用户提供流畅、快速的浏览体验,页面性能监控变得尤为重要。本文将详细介绍页面性能监控的指标,帮助您更好地优化网站性能。

一、页面加载时间

页面加载时间是衡量页面性能的重要指标之一。它反映了用户打开页面所需的时间,通常包括以下几个阶段:

  • DNS解析时间:浏览器解析域名到IP地址的时间。
  • 建立连接时间:浏览器与服务器建立连接的时间。
  • 请求时间:浏览器向服务器发送请求并等待响应的时间。
  • 响应时间:服务器处理请求并返回响应的时间。
  • DOM渲染时间:浏览器解析HTML文档并构建DOM树的时间。
  • 资源加载时间:浏览器加载CSS、JavaScript、图片等资源的时间。

二、页面渲染时间

页面渲染时间是指从页面开始加载到完全显示所需的时间。它包括以下几个阶段:

  • 白屏时间:页面开始加载到出现第一个元素的时间。
  • 内容渲染时间:页面完全加载并显示内容的时间。
  • 交互渲染时间:用户与页面进行交互时,页面响应的时间。

三、关键渲染路径(CRP)

关键渲染路径是指浏览器在渲染页面时需要执行的步骤。优化关键渲染路径可以显著提高页面性能。以下是一些关键渲染路径的优化方法:

  • 懒加载:将非关键资源(如图片、视频等)延迟加载,减少页面加载时间。
  • 预加载:提前加载用户可能需要访问的资源,提高页面响应速度。
  • 减少重绘和回流:避免频繁的DOM操作,减少重绘和回流次数。

四、页面交互性能

页面交互性能是指用户与页面进行交互时的响应速度。以下是一些提高页面交互性能的方法:

  • 使用原生JavaScript:避免过度依赖第三方库,减少页面加载时间。
  • 优化JavaScript代码:压缩、合并、缓存JavaScript代码,提高执行效率。
  • 使用Web Workers:将耗时的JavaScript操作放在后台线程执行,避免阻塞主线程。

五、案例分析

以下是一个关于页面性能优化的案例分析:

某电商平台在页面性能优化前,页面加载时间为10秒,页面交互响应时间为3秒。经过优化后,页面加载时间缩短至5秒,页面交互响应时间缩短至1秒。优化后的页面性能得到了显著提升,用户满意度也得到了提高。

总结

页面性能监控指标对于网站优化具有重要意义。通过关注页面加载时间、页面渲染时间、关键渲染路径、页面交互性能等指标,我们可以及时发现并解决页面性能问题,为用户提供更好的浏览体验。在实际操作中,我们需要根据具体情况选择合适的优化方法,以达到最佳效果。

猜你喜欢:微服务监控